Jogging routes around Hartsdale offer a diverse environment for outdoor activity, characterized by extensive park systems and well-maintained trails. The region features a mix of older woods, meadows, and wetlands, providing varied scenery. Notable areas include Hart's Brook Park and Ridge Road Park, which offer wooded trails with some rolling hill terrain. The Bronx River Pathway also provides access to a multi-use trail system, ideal for longer runs alongside the river.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many running routes are available around Hartsdale?

There are over 80 dedicated running routes around Hartsdale, offering a wide variety of options for different preferences and fitness levels. The komoot community has explored these trails extensively, with over 800 runners using the platform to discover the area's diverse terrain.

What kind of terrain can I expect on jogging routes in Hartsdale?

Jogging routes in Hartsdale feature a diverse mix of natural landscapes. You'll find trails winding through older woods and meadows, as well as wetlands. Parks like Hart's Brook Park and Ridge Road Park offer mainly wooded trails with some rolling hill terrain. The Bronx River Pathway provides primarily paved surfaces, ideal for longer, smoother runs.

Are there any scenic viewpoints or natural landmarks along the running paths?

Yes, many running paths in Hartsdale offer scenic views and access to natural landmarks. The Bronx River Pathway loop from White Plains, for instance, offers beautiful views alongside the Bronx River. You can also find attractions like the Kensico Reservoir and even the Peanut Leap Cascade near some routes, providing picturesque backdrops for your run.

What is the overall difficulty level of running trails in Hartsdale?

Hartsdale offers a good range of difficulty levels. While there are 7 easy routes perfect for beginners or a relaxed jog, the majority (67 routes) are considered moderate. For those seeking a greater challenge, there are also 13 difficult routes available, often featuring longer distances or more varied elevation.

Are there any family-friendly running trails in Hartsdale?

Yes, several parks in and around Hartsdale are suitable for family outings, offering trails that are generally easy to navigate. The Greenburgh Nature Center, though a short distance away, provides peaceful walking trails in a natural setting that can be enjoyed by families. Many sections of the Bronx River Pathway are also relatively flat and wide, making them suitable for families.

Are there any dog-friendly jogging trails in Hartsdale?

Many of Hartsdale's parks and trails, including those within Hart's Brook Park and Ridge Road Park, are generally dog-friendly, allowing leashed dogs. The Bronx River Pathway is also a popular spot for runners with dogs. It's always a good idea to check specific park regulations before heading out, but the area is welcoming to canine companions.

Are there circular running routes available in Hartsdale?

Yes, Hartsdale features several excellent circular running routes. A popular option is the Bronx River Pathway – Bronx River Pathway loop from Hartsdale, which is a moderate 4.5-mile (7.3 km) trail. Another longer circular route is the Martine’s Fine Bake Shoppe loop from Hartsdale, covering 8.3 miles (13.3 km).

What do other runners enjoy the most about jogging in Hartsdale?

The running routes in Hartsdale are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.9 stars from more than 5 reviews. Runners often praise the extensive park systems, the variety of wooded trails, and the accessibility of the multi-use Bronx River Pathway. The diverse scenery, from older woods to meadows, is also frequently highlighted as a positive aspect.

Are there any longer running routes for endurance training?

Absolutely. For those looking for a longer challenge, the Bronx River Pathway loop from Hartsdale is a difficult 10.9-mile (17.5 km) path that offers an extended run through varied landscapes. Another great option is the Bronx River Pathway – Bronx River Pathway loop from White Plains, which spans 8 miles (12.8 km).

Are there any running routes that are part of a larger trail system?

Yes, Hartsdale provides excellent access to the broader Bronx River Pathway, a popular multi-use trail system. This pathway allows joggers to connect to various sections, offering varied distances and difficulty levels, primarily on paved surfaces. It's a great way to explore more of the region beyond Hartsdale itself.

Are there any accessible trails for people with mobility concerns?

Ridge Road Park in Hartsdale is notably part of the "Trails Without Limits" program. This initiative offers all-terrain track chairs to individuals with mobility concerns, ensuring that everyone has the opportunity to experience and enjoy the trails. This highlights the area's commitment to accessible outdoor recreation.
